How they compare
Costa Rica currently reports 135.6 against 108.89 in Fiji, a difference of 26.71.
That makes Costa Rica's figure about 1.2 times Fiji's.
Across all 22 years both countries report, Costa Rica has been ahead every year.
Costa Rica ranks 119th and Fiji ranks 122nd of 193 countries.
Costa Rica has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Costa Rica | Fiji |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 212.81 | 100.88 | 111.93 | Costa Rica |
| 2010s | 181.54 | 89.74 | 91.8 | Costa Rica |
| 2020s | 139.73 | 108.41 | 31.32 | Costa Rica |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
